Phased research strategy to de-risk market entry
linking phased research to a technical roadmap.
foundational market and behavior research, then localized usability and infrastructure validation, then iterative post-launch measurement, each feeding l10n, infra, and feature work.
WHAT THIS TESTS The interviewer wants strategic sequencing plus the discipline to connect each research insight to a specific technical decision, proving research de-risks rather than decorates the expansion.
A GOOD ANSWER COVERS Phase one, foundational discovery before committing build resources: market sizing, competitive landscape, cultural norms and expectations, language and script needs, dominant devices and OS versions, network conditions and connectivity, plus payment methods and regulatory and data-residency requirements. Phase two, design and infrastructure validation: usability test localized and culturally adapted designs with in-market participants, not just translated strings, and validate technical assumptions like latency from local regions, right-to-left layout support, character handling, and integration with local payment providers. Phase three, post-launch iteration: instrument in-market metrics, run continuous evaluative research, and refine. Critically, map insights to the roadmap. Connectivity and device findings drive performance budgets and offline support; script and cultural findings drive localization beyond translation, including layout, imagery, and date and currency formats; regulatory findings drive data residency and consent infrastructure; payment findings drive market-specific integrations and features.
COMMON WRONG ANSWERS Treating localization as only translating text, ignoring layout, formats, imagery, and tone. Assuming the home market's devices and bandwidth. Overlooking legal and data-residency constraints until launch. Doing one upfront study and never validating after entry.
LIKELY FOLLOW-UPS How do you recruit representative in-market participants. What is the difference between localization and internationalization in code. How do data-residency laws change your architecture. How do you prioritize which markets first.
ONE CONCRETE EXAMPLE Entering a market on predominantly low-end Android phones with intermittent connectivity, phase one reveals a need for offline support and a local payment wallet. This directly sets a strict performance budget and offline cache work on the roadmap, a wallet integration as a market-specific feature, and in-region hosting to meet data-residency law, all before a single localized screen ships.
